Job description
Duties & Responsibilities
  • Carry out preventative maintenance of electronic security systems
  • Carry out reactive fault investigation and repairs of electronic security systems
  • To provide reliable, quality support to our customers at all times
  • To have a professional telephone and face to face manor
  • Assist clients and regional team with technical issues either on the phone or face to face
  • Have a flexible approach to working hours when required
Skills & Experience
  • Must have a high level of experience of our industry
  • Excellent technical knowledge of security systems
  • Have a systematic/logical approach to tasks & problems
  • Ensure all tasks are carried out quickly & efficiently
  • Be presentable in person and in vehicle and tools
  • Excellent communication and organisational skills
  • Be aware of and responsible for the equipment required to complete the necessary works including emergency van stock.
  • Understand the need for precise completion of paperwork records of jobs and full use of PDA device.
  • Have a polite but assertive telephone manor
  • Good knowledge of London and the home counties postcodes
  • Good customer service skills ability to motivate staff & colleagues and lead by example
  • The ability to think laterally and "out of the box"
  • Prompt and consistent time keeping
